Adds a scannable What it detects section near the top of the README, per discoverability advice (lead with the TrustFall keyword + a ✅ checklist of covered agents and built-in capabilities).

Why

"TrustFall-style AI agent attacks" is currently the strongest search/keyword hook, and the README buried its agent coverage and capabilities far below the fold. This puts both up top.

Accuracy

Every claim maps to a shipped feature — nothing aspirational:

Deliberately omits tool-poisoning detection — that's #148 (still Future) and would be overclaiming.

Surfaces the TrustFall-style AI-agent-attack detection and the covered
agents / built-in capabilities as a scannable checklist high in the README,
for discoverability. All claims map to shipped features:
- TrustFall (project-scope MCP auto-execution) — #153
- prompt-injection directives in instruction files — #155
- sandbox-disabled / auto-approve / broad-permission / remote-MCP scoring
- 7 agent parsers (Claude Code, Codex, Cursor, Gemini CLI, Antigravity,
  Continue.dev, Claude Desktop)
- SIEM integration, read-only MCP (host + fleet), fleet monitoring,
  signed policy distribution

No tool-poisoning claim (that's #148, still Future).
